Unlocking the Secret to Glowing Skin: The Benefits of Skin Cycling Routines

Recently, skin cycling routines have been making waves in the beauty industry, with celebrities and influencers swearing by its effectiveness. Dermatologists have also been raving about its benefits, emphasizing how it can help the skin adapt to different environmental conditions, hormones, and the skin's natural cycles.

So, what exactly is skin cycling? It's a practice where you switch up your skincare routine according to your skin's natural cycles, which vary throughout the month. During the menstrual cycle, for example, the skin's oil production increases, and the skin may become more prone to breakouts. Skin cycling routines adjust to these changes, using different products and techniques to ensure the skin's optimal health and appearance. To create an effective skin cycling routine, you'll need to consider your skin type and its specific needs. Here's an example of a skin cycling routine that suits all skin types:
